WESTBOROUGH – The Assabet Valley Mastersingers have announced their Summer Sing event, taking place on Monday, Aug. 21, at 7:30 p.m. 

Music enthusiasts and choral aficionados are invited to join the group for an evening of harmony at Congregation B’nai Shalom.

The featured work for this year’s Summer Sing is Ralph Vaughan Williams’ masterpiece, “Dona Nobis Pacem.” This choral composition promises to captivate the audience with its rich harmonies and emotive storytelling. 

Under the skillful direction of conductor Robert Eaton, the Assabet Valley Mastersingers will showcase their remarkable talent, alongside professional soloists, while inviting the public to sing along. Bring your own score or borrow one at the door.

Admission is $10 at the door.
